概括
基因分析揭示了27种免疫细胞表型,与心肌梗塞 (MI) 有因果关系. 一些免疫细胞降低了心脏病发作风险,而另一些免疫细胞增加了心脏病发作风险,提供了新的诊断和治疗点.

背景情况:
- 心肌梗塞 (MI) 是全球主要的死亡原因.
- 免疫细胞和心脏病发作之间的关系是复杂的,观察性研究仅限于混因素和反向因果关系.
- 建立免疫反应和心脏病发作之间的因果关系对于了解疾病机制至关重要.
研究的目的:
- 调查基因决定的免疫细胞表型对心脏病发作风险的潜在因果影响.
- 利用大规模的遗传数据,探索免疫细胞在心脏病发作中的病因作用.
主要方法:
- 使用公开可用的全基因组关联研究数据进行了两样本的门德尔随机化 (MR) 分析.
- 与撒丁岛人731个免疫细胞签名相关的遗传变异作为暴露工具.
- 用MI的总结统计数据作为结果,使用逆方差加权,MR-egger和简单的中位数方法.
主要成果:
- 在731种免疫细胞表型中,27种表型显示出与心脏病发作具有统计学意义的因果关系.
- 14种免疫类型与心脏病发作风险相反相关,这表明它们有保护作用.
- 13种免疫类型与心脏病发作有积极关联,这表明风险增加.
结论:
- 这项遗传研究提供了强有力的证据,证明了特定免疫细胞表型和MI之间的因果关系.
- 已识别的免疫细胞特征可以作为预测心脏病发作风险的新生物标志物.
- 这些发现突出了潜在的新治疗点,用于预防和治疗心脏病发作.
